Head coach Kim Eun-joong was delighted with the win over France.
Kim Eun-joong’s South Korea U-20 team defeated France 2-1 in their U-20 World Cup Group F match at the Estadio Malvinas Argentina in Mendoza, Argentina, at 3:00 a.m. ET on Wednesday, March 23, thanks to a first-half goal from Lee Seung-won (Gangwon) and a second-half goal from Lee Young-joon (Gimcheon).
It was an unexpected victory. France is in a better place than it was after winning the tournament. South Korea is one of the strongest teams in the tournament, but it was widely believed that they were not as strong as France. Speaking to FIFA Plus after the match, coach Kim Eun-joong said, “France were better than after the win. We made our own preparations. We defended well and prepared for a counter-attack. The players responded well,” he said. “At the end, France attacked. Our defenders stayed focused and didn’t concede a goal. I’m grateful for that.”
When asked to name a player of the match, Kim gave credit to all of his players, saying, “All 21 players played as a team.” “Our remaining matches against Honduras and Gambia are also not easy,” Kim said. We will prepare thoroughly and play a good game.”
